Description |
Fl. forming a double triangle, 92 mm wide, facing slightly up; perianth segments 40 mm long, very broadly ovate, blunt, mucronate, spreading, plane to a little concave, smooth and of heavy substance, overlapping one-third to a half; the inner segments narrower, shouldered at base; corona 30 mm long, funnel-shaped, broadly ribbed, mouth straight and wavy. Mid-season. Sweetly scented |
